Build children’s vocabulary through play with this Happy Families style synonym card game.
This engaging resource helps pupils recognise synonyms, expand their vocabulary and make better word choices in their speaking and writing while enjoying a classic card game.
Players collect complete synonym families by asking one another for matching cards, just like the traditional game of Happy Families.
